Adjective[edit]

optioned (not comparable)

  1. (in combination) Having the specified kind or number of options.
    • 1982, John Gunnell, How to Restore & Upgrade Your Vintage Car with Factory Accessories, page 143:
      It is also possible to have an unusually optioned car which is not a prepackaged special edition type. This would be the kind of car I mentioned earlier — one of 90 made with red upholstery of 2,000 made with a blue vinyl top.
